About The Position

The Behavioral Health Technician position is responsible for providing direct and supportive care to clients/patients. This includes monitoring daily activities, intervening/responding to crises, facilitating group education and structured activities, and transporting clients as needed. Behavioral Health Technicians are responsible for understanding the client's/patient's treatment plan, documenting their behaviors, and providing a safe, therapeutic, and supportive environment.

Responsibilities

  • Participate as an integral member of the treatment team, assisting in identifying client strengths, needs, abilities, and preferences.
  • Carrying out any additional requests from your supervisor.
  • Ensure adherence to all program expectations and rules, reporting behaviors to supervisors for effective therapeutic interventions
  • Adhere rigorously to all medication policies and collaborate with trained nursing staff to guarantee compliance, whether the medication is administered by the client/patient or PFH associate.
  • Assist in the admission/orientation process, including obtaining vital signs if applicable, safety searches of client/patient and belongings, and collecting any necessary urine/lab specimens for testing.
  • Assist and educate clients/patients in performing daily activities as needed.
  • Provide transportation support for clients/patients as required.
